Pesto Hummus

Is anyone else trying to eat a little healthier this year? Homemade hummus is incredibly easy and uses such simple ingredients! It is also so versatile; I add it to salads, spread it on sandwiches and of course dip veggies in it for a healthy snack. You know what is better than regular hummus? PESTO hummus! That’s right, just add a little pesto to your hummus and you have a delicious crossover that anyone will love.

Ingredients

  • 1 (15 oz.) can garbanzo beans (chickpeas), drained and rinsed
  • 1/3 cup pesto
  • 2 tablespoons water
  • 2-3 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 1.5 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 garlic clove
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• Sprinkle sea salt to taste

Directions

  1. Place all ingredients in a food processor and pulse until creamy
  2. Add extra olive oil if consistency is too thick
  3. Salt to taste
  4. Refrigerate leftovers for up to 1 week
